Freedom of Choice Ohio (FOCO)

Freedom of Choice Ohio (FOCO) was established in the mid-1970’s as a pro-choice coalition to advocate for reproductive rights and to provide member organizations and the public with information and education on public policy matters related to protecting and preserving reproductive freedom, including the availability of safe, legal abortion and contraception. Membership is comprised of local and/or state organizations that support freedom of choice.

FOCO works…
To foster development of the pro-choice movement,
To educate legislators through informational materials,
To produce and distribute legislative updates and alerts,
To conduct public outreach through participation in community events,
To advance the pro-choice message.

Recent activities include:
Promotion of contraceptive equity legislation,
Peaceful presence and escort training for clinic escorts,
Distribution of information at community events,
Advocacy for adequate state funding for women’s health programs,
30th Anniversary of Roe v. Wade Event.
